This is a mule deer buck my dad glassed. He was hunting a friend and glassed this buck up. It is the biggest mule deer he has seen in his life. Here is the story, My dad got out of the truck and started to glass. He glassed the buck, it was one of the "We need to kill this deer" right when you see him things. Dad tells his friend "We need to kill this deer" the friend "What do you think he is"? Dad "I don't know, we just need to kill him, he's big". Dad tells his buddy, "Hey this is how we need to get on this buck and what to do". Well my dad takes off walking, He looks behind him and his buddy's gone! Gets on the radio, "Where are you"....... Nothing. He waits for his buddy, waits and waits. Finally he said screw it I'm going to walk on top this knob, he was thinking the buck would be about 300 yards. Well he walks on the knob and the buck was at 300 yards....... No shooter! So he walked back out, no radio, nothing. I guess I will go take some pictures he said. He finally gets the guy on the radio after he got the pictures and walked back out! He said get over here. Long story short the buck walked over the hill. The friend told my dad he was chasing around a little buck and some does. Why do you chase deer your not going to shoot????? Anyway, that evening they got at 500 yards. The friend didn't feel good enough to take the shot (300 yards is far for him). The next day they got at 500 yards again. He took the shot..... Shot 5+ times, never got within 10-15 yards of the deer.
